Grassy Pointe at a glance

Pinellas · Tarpon Springs · Deed-Restricted Value

Established, deed-restricted Tarpon Springs community of early-2000s one- and two-story homes: mainly three- and four-bedroom with two- and three-car garages, many with pools and conservation views, with natural gas and a modest HOA (around $565 a year for 2025), near the Pinellas Trail and Fred Howard Park. How accurate are online estimates for Grassy Pointe homes?

Automated estimates struggle with community-specific factors like fee structures, lot premiums, and street-by-street differences. They are a starting point, not a number to act on. An agent valuation uses closed sales and current competition.
